Abstract

Let $(X, \tau)$ be a topological space and $(X, \tau^{\ast})$ its semiregularization. Then a topological property ${\Cal P}$ is semiregular provided that $\tau$ has property ${\Cal P}$ if and only if $\tau^{\ast}$ has the same property. In this work we study semiregular property of almost Lindelöf, weakly Lindelöf, nearly regular-Lindelöf, almost regular-Lindelöf and weakly regular-Lindelöf spaces. We prove that all these topological properties, on the contrary of Lindelöf property, are semiregular properties.

Abstract

The construction of all irreducible modules of the symmetric groups over an arbitrary field which reduce to Specht modules in the case of fields of characteristic zero is given by G. D. James. Hal\i c\i o{ğ}lu and Morris describe a possible extension of James' work for Weyl groups in general, where Young tableaux are interpreted in terms of root systems. In this paper, we further develop the theory and give a possible extension of this construction for finite reflection groups which cover the Weyl groups.

Abstract

First boundary value problem for elliptic equation with youngest coefficient containing Dirac distribution concentrated on a smooth curve is considered. For this problem a finite difference scheme on a special quasiregular grid is constructed. The finite difference scheme converges in discrete $W_2^1$ norm with the rate $O(h^{3/2})$. Convergence rate is compatible with the smoothness of input data.
